Setting Up Your First Gaming PC

Choosing the Right Hardware

Before you jump into graphics settings and frame rates, remember this: great gameplay starts with great hardware. Here's what you need to know:

● CPU (Processor): Think of this as the brain of your PC. A good CPU ensures smooth performance.

● GPU (Graphics Card): This makes your games look amazing. For beginners, mid-range cards like the NVIDIA GTX or AMD RX series work great.

● RAM (Memory): More RAM means better multitasking. Aim for at least 16GB for modern games.

● Storage: SSDs load games faster than HDDs. A 500GB SSD is a good start.

Optimizing Your Display and Graphics Settings

A great monitor makes a huge difference. These are the facts that you need to keep in mind while optimizing your gaming PC:

● Refresh Rate: Think of this like flipping through a picture book - more pages (higher Hz) means smoother motion. A 144Hz monitor makes fast action look superfluid.

● Resolution: 1080p gives great quality for most setups. If your graphics card is powerful, you can enjoy sharper 1440p or ultra-crisp 4K visuals. 

● Game Settings: Medium settings are your best starting point. If things feel choppy, try lowering some options.

Keyboard, Mouse, and Peripherals for Gaming

The right gear improves control and comfort:

● Mechanical Keyboards: Faster response for quick actions.

● Gaming Mouse: Adjustable DPI helps in aiming (higher DPI for fast movements, lower for precision).

● Headset: Clear audio helps in multiplayer games.

Essential Software and Game Optimization

Keeping Drivers and Software Updated

Outdated drivers can slow down your games. Always update:

● GPU Drivers: Use NVIDIA GeForce Experience or AMD Adrenalin for automatic updates.

● Game Launchers: Steam, Epic Games, and GOG keep your games up to date.

● System Tools: Apps like MSI Afterburner help monitor performance.

Tweaking Windows and In-Game Settings

Small changes can boost speed:

● Power Settings: Set to "High Performance" in Windows.

● Background Apps: Close unnecessary apps to free up RAM.

● In-game settings: Lower shadows and effects for better FPS.

Managing Storage and Game Library

Games take up a lot of space. Here's how to manage them:

● SSD for Games: Install your favorite games on an SSD for faster loading.

● HDD for Storage: Use a bigger HDD for older games.

● Cloud Backups: Steam and other platforms save your progress online.

Learning the Basics of Online and Competitive Gaming

Understanding Internet and Network Settings

A stable connection is key for online gaming:

●  Wired vs. Wireless: Ethernet cables reduce lag compared to Wi-Fi.

●  Internet Speed: At least 50 Mbps is good for smooth online play.

●  Ping/Latency: Lower ping (under 50ms) means less delay.

Joining the PC Gaming Community

Gaming is more fun with friends!

● Discord and Reddit: Great places to find teammates and tips.

● Beginner-Friendly Games: Try games like Fortnite, Rocket League, or Minecraft before jumping into hardcore shooters.

● Practice and Patience: Even pros started as beginners, keep playing to improve.

FAQs

What's the configuration of the best gaming PC for beginners?

A great starter PC should balance performance and affordability. Look for at least:

CPU: Intel Core i5 or AMD Ryzen 5

GPU: NVIDIA GTX 1660 or AMD RX 6600

RAM: 16GB

Storage: 500GB SSD

How do I make my games run smoother?

Try these quick fixes:

Lower in-game graphics settings (start with "Medium").

Update your GPU drivers (NVIDIA/AMD software does this automatically).

Close background apps to free up RAM.

Use a wired Ethernet connection for online gaming.
